About the Item

A fine example of American Arts & Crafts metalwork by the Roycroft community, this copper crumber and tray set was produced in East Aurora, New York, in the early 20th century. Designed for table service, the long handled crumber and coordinating tray are hand-hammered with a warm patinated surface, showcasing the distinctive craftsmanship of the Roycrofters. The crumber features a gracefully curved handle and wide blade, perfectly fitted to sweep crumbs into the shallow tray. Both pieces bear the hand-wrought character that defines Roycroft copper, with simple lines elevated by the honest beauty of the hammered finish. Provenance & Maker Founded by Elbert Hubbard in 1895, the Roycroft community became a central force in the American Arts & Crafts movement, creating furniture, lighting, and metalwork of enduring quality and design. Copper pieces such as this set were highly regarded for their marriage of function and artistry, embodying the ideals of handcrafted integrity.
